| Show risk I Fiends Numerous complaints come in from the neighborhood of the mountain streams about fish fiends They are the destroyers of the denizens of tho brooks who not content with enjoying the regular anglers an-glers sport and catching their prey with look and line resort to giant powder and other improper means of gaining big hauls of fish It is shameful that the streams should be thus denuded of the scaly tribes that find in them their natural home and the fishermans best haunts be thus robbed of their chief charms It is butchery of the worst kind and is in violation of the territorial ter-ritorial laws We have a fish and game commissioner iu Utah It would be a good thing if he would depute some reliable anglers to act 10 his behalf and they would prosecute the fish fiends as the law provides A little detective work on the Weber and Provo rivers up towards the head waters also on Parleys creek and other streams and on the borders of the lakes would result re-sult in the exposure of some of those lawless law-less despoilers of the waters and a few fish would be left for present and future lovers of legitimate sport What has the commissioner to say on this subject |
